Quote

AmigaHeretic wrote:
No, in one of the pictures on the side of the cd drive you can see 4 plastic screw type adjustemnts.  You use those.

Here are instructions for aligning the CD drive on a CD32.  Might work for the CDTV or you can probably find specs for the drive.
Amiga CD32 CD-ROM Lens alignment
